温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

math库在地质勘探数据处理中的应用

发布时间:2024-11-18 16:21:14 来源:亿速云 阅读:88 作者:小樊 栏目:编程语言

math库在地质勘探数据处理中有着广泛的应用。以下是一些主要的应用场景:

  1. 数据预处理

    • 数据清洗:在地质勘探中,原始数据可能包含噪声、异常值或缺失值。使用math库中的函数(如isinf()isnan())可以检测并处理这些数据。
    • 数据转换:将原始数据转换为适合分析的格式。例如,可以使用math库中的数学函数对数据进行标准化、归一化等操作。
  2. 统计分析

    • 描述性统计:计算均值、中位数、方差、标准差等统计量,以描述数据的分布特征。
    • 假设检验:利用math库中的函数进行t检验、F检验等,以判断样本数据是否符合某种理论分布或比较两组数据的差异。
  3. 插值与拟合

    • 线性插值:使用math库中的线性插值方法,根据已知数据点估算未知数据点的值。这在地质勘探中常用于填补数据空白。
    • 曲线拟合:通过最小二乘法或其他优化算法,利用math库中的函数对散点数据进行曲线拟合,以揭示数据间的内在关系。
  4. 几何计算

    • 坐标变换:在地质勘探中,经常需要进行坐标系的转换。math库提供了丰富的三角函数和矩阵运算功能,可以用于实现这一目的。
    • 距离和角度计算:计算两点之间的距离、方位角、夹角等几何量,这在地质勘探的数据分析和解释中非常重要。
  5. 优化算法

    • 梯度下降法:在地质勘探中,优化算法的应用也很广泛。math库提供了基本的数学运算功能,可以与其他库(如scipy)结合使用,实现更高效的优化算法。
  6. 数据可视化

    • 绘制图表:利用math库中的数学函数和图形库(如matplotlib),可以绘制各种地质勘探数据的图表,如散点图、折线图、柱状图等,以便更直观地展示和分析数据。

总之,math库在地质勘探数据处理中发挥着重要作用,为地质学家和研究人员提供了强大的数学计算和统计分析功能。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

c++
AI